Job Description:
A position is available for a research associate to conduct research within a project funded by BBSRC investigating the role of chromatin structure in gene expression in Drosophila melanogaster.

The successful candidate will have a postgraduate degree at PhD level in a related subject area or relevant industrial experience, proven ability to publish in international journals and a proven portfolio of research and/or relevant industrial experience within at least 3 of the following research fields:

* Drosophila genetics

* Developmental biology, especially regulation of gene expression

* Molecular biology, including RNA and DNA purification, PCR, cloning.

* Cell biology, including FACS analysis.

* Illumina sequencing.

* Bioinformatics, especially analysis of data sets generated by high throughput sequencing such as RNA-seq, ChIP-seq and MNase-seq
